Google Launchpad Accelerator India chapter to nurture desi startups
The three-month "Launchpad Accelerator" India programme has been designed to grow the AI/ML ecosystem by helping desi startups build scalable solutions for the country s unique problems.
The programme based out of Bengaluru will provide a cohort of 8-10 Indian startups mentorship and support from the best of Google in AI/ML Cloud UX Android web product strategy and marketing along with up to $100K of Google Cloud credits the company said in a statement.
"India has the appetite to build entrepreneurs of the future and we are proud to announce a focused programme for the next wave of Indian entrepreneurs who are using new technologies to solve the country s needs " said Roy Glasberg Global Launchpad Founder.
Over the years Google has worked with some incredible startups across India who are using advanced technologies such as AI/ML to tackle everything from agri-tech to language web healthcare and transportation.
"With the dedicated India-only Launchpad Accelerator programme we will be able to build a bridge between startups and the industry ecosystem and support them to drive innovation in the India market " Glasberg added.
Applications for the first class is open till July 31 and the first class will start in September 2018.
In an effort to mentor emerging start-ups Google India hosted a four-day boot camp for the first 10 Indian startups as part of its Solve for India programme.
The India-focused accelerator programme is building on Google s "Solve for India" roadshow from last year.
Ten Indian startups were shortlisted from across India which underwent four days in one-on-one consults with experts from Google and mentors from the industry to solve critical product and growth challenges.
"We shortlisted 10 startups from 160 home-grown start-ups by travelling across 15 cities in India and are now ready to scale this pilot as a dedicated programme for India " Karthik Padmanabhan Developer Relations Lead Google India said at that time.
The participants were the founders of startups including Nebulaa Slang Labs PregBuddy LegalDesk PaySack Vokal FarMart Meesho Pratilipi and M-Indicator.
"Launchpad" regional accelerators are tailored specifically to their local markets helping startups build great products Google said.
